本文目錄導讀:
CSS制作立體正方體的藝術
在現(xiàn)代網(wǎng)頁設計中,利用CSS創(chuàng)建三維元素已經(jīng)成為一種流行趨勢,本文將介紹如何通過CSS創(chuàng)建立體正方體,讓你的網(wǎng)頁更具動感和立體感。
準備工作
你需要對CSS有一定的了解,包括選擇器、屬性、值等基本概念,熟悉盒模型、布局和定位等CSS核心知識,將有助于你更好地完成立體正方體的制作。
創(chuàng)建基本結構
使用HTML創(chuàng)建一個div元素,作為正方體的容器,通過CSS設置其尺寸和樣式,為正方體打下基礎。
應用立體效果
通過CSS的transform屬性,可以實現(xiàn)立體效果,使用translate()、rotate()和scale()等函數(shù),調(diào)整正方體的位置、旋轉和大小,使其呈現(xiàn)出立體的外觀。
細節(jié)調(diào)整
為了增強立體效果,可以通過調(diào)整光影、材質(zhì)和顏色等細節(jié),使用box-shadow屬性添加陰影,使用background-image設置材質(zhì),使用color屬性調(diào)整顏色。
響應式設計
為了使正方體在不同設備上都能***展示,需要考慮到響應式設計,通過媒體查詢(media queries)和視窗單位(viewport units),可以根據(jù)屏幕大小調(diào)整正方體的尺寸和布局。
優(yōu)化與拓展
完成基本制作后,你可以進一步優(yōu)化和拓展你的立體正方體,添加動畫效果、交互功能,或者將其與其他網(wǎng)頁元素結合,創(chuàng)造出更豐富的視覺效果。
通過CSS的transform屬性、盒模型以及其他相關屬性,我們可以輕松創(chuàng)建出立體正方體,這種技術不僅可以提升網(wǎng)頁的視覺效果,還可以增強用戶的交互體驗,希望本文的介紹能對你有所幫助,讓你在網(wǎng)頁設計中發(fā)揮出更多的創(chuàng)意。